免安裝的mysql配置

2021-08-07 22:16:57 字數 1995 閱讀 7629

第一步:解壓壓縮包,我的是d:mysql

第二步:配置環境變數,在path變數後面追加;d:\mysql\bin

第三步:在mysql目錄下新建my.ini

配置如下:

[mysqld]

#新版不支援在my.ini中直接設定字符集為utf8。解決方法是在default-character-set前面加上loose-。

loose-default-character-set = utf8

#加loose-後mysql啟動是不再報錯了,但是在插入資料時依然出現了亂碼問題。解決方法是加入character-set-server。

character-set-server = utf8

#如果是伺服器用的話,建議設大點。

innodb_buffer_pool_size = 128m

#基路徑

basedir = c:\mysql

#資料路徑 這個要變 變成你的目錄

datadir = c:\mysql/data

default-storage-engine=myisam

#日誌路徑 這個要變 變成你的目錄

log_bin = c:\mysql/log

#如果不加這行,預設是監聽127.0.0.0,加了後是監聽區域網埠和外網埠。

#bind-address = 0.0.0.0

#監聽埠

port = 3306

#這個是免密碼登陸 第一次使用可以加上這句話 然後去資料庫修改root使用者密碼 記住修改完了要注釋掉

#skip-grant-tables

[client]

loose-default-character-set = utf8

#這個要變 變成你的目錄

[winmysqladmin]

server = c:\mysql/bin/mysqld.exe

*************************分割線*******************

如果後續需要什麼配置的往後追加,比如儲存引擎等等。
要記住上面的路徑要那樣寫c:\mysql/log,否則就載入不到。

第四步:載入mysql

在dos輸入:mysqld -install

如果要解除安裝: mysqld -remove

第五步:啟動mysql

在dos下:net start mysql

如果要停止:net stop mysql

第六步:直接進入mysql 這時候root使用者是免密碼

mysql -u root -p
第七步:修改密碼:

乙個語句乙個語句輸入:

> show databases;

>use mysql;

>update user set password=password(『root』) where user=『root』;

>flush privileges;

>quit;

然後重新登入就好了

出現錯誤:

(1)錯誤1

在 net start mysql時候

發生系統錯誤 2。系統找不到指定的檔案。

解決辦法:

先將你安裝的移除了 mysqld -remove

然後在bin目錄下安裝,啟動服務*

(2)載入和啟動一定要全程使用管理員許可權的dos視窗。

如果找不到的話可以這樣在c:\windows\system32下找cmd.exe檔案然後右擊用管理員許可權開啟。

(3)「the service already exists

在cmd中輸入」sc query mysql」檢視名為mysql的服務

服務確實存在,則進行刪除操作「sc delete mysql"

如果刪除不了,那就是服務還在啟動中 那就要進到任務管理器殺死他。

然後在刪除。

mysql免安裝 mysql 免安裝配置

2 配置環境變數 1 解壓目錄 d mysql 8.0.16 winx64 2 配置環境變數 3 新增配置檔案 1 配置檔案目錄 d mysql 8.0.16 winx64 2 配置檔名 my.ini 3 檔案內容 mysql 設定mysql客戶端預設字符集 default character se...

mysql免安裝配置

新增my.ini 內容 mysqld skip grant tables basedir e mysql 5.7.22 winx64 datadir e mysql 5.7.22 winx64 data port 3306 character set server utf8 data目錄不要手動建立...

mysql 免安裝配置

1 解壓目錄 d mysql 8.0.16 winx64 2 配置環境變數 1 配置檔案目錄 d mysql 8.0.16 winx64 2 配置檔名 my.ini 3 檔案內容 注這裡的my.ini檔案和data檔案如果解壓檔案中沒有可以手動建立一下 client port 3306 defaul...